The correlation between historical prices or returns on SES SA and Aurora Innovation is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Aurora Innovation are associated (or correlated) with SES SA.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of SES SA has no effect on the direction of Aurora Innovation i.e., Aurora Innovation and SES SA go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Aurora Innovation and SES SA
The main advantage of trading using opposite Aurora Innovation and SES SA posit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Aurora Innovation position performs unexpectedly, SES SA can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
